The sources primarily contain excerpts from the novel Water for Elephants by Sara Gruen, which detail the experiences of a young man, Jacob, who runs away to join a struggling circus during the Great Depression. The narrative shifts between Jacob's youthful adventures with the Benzini Brothers Circus, featuring characters like the cruel animal trainer August, his wife Marlena, and the elephant Rosie, and Jacob's current life as a nonagenarian in an assisted living facility. Interspersed with the narrative are positive literary reviews of the book, as well as an author interview and a note on the book's historical research, confirming that many outrageous circus events and the tragedy of Jamaica ginger paralysis were drawn from real-life history.
